NFL Alumni Association Will Supply Discounted COVID-19 Antibody Tests to Retired Players

Biotechnology firm RayBiotech has partnered with the NFL Alumni Association to supply COVID-19 rapid antibody test kits to retired NFL players. The tests detect the presence of IgM or IgG antibodies via a finger prick blood sample.

The partnership includes agreements with healthcare providers Streamline Medical Group and 1271 Partners, who will distribute RayBiotech’s tests to the NFL Alumni Association. RayBiotech’s COVID-19 test kits are being sold on its website to laboratory and health professionals for $280. According to an NFL Alumni press release, NFLA members and their families can now purchase the kits at a 50% discount.

The NFL Alumni Association consists of 35 chapters across the U.S. Players and staff across Major League Baseball recently joined a massive antibody study in hopes of determining the true scale of COVID-19 in the U.S.
